📌 I. Product Definition & Classification: Do You Really Understand "Medicament"?
Medicament is a broad commercial term referring to any substance or preparation used for treating, curing, or preventing diseases. In international trade, the classification of "Medicament" is highly sensitive and depends entirely on: 1. Active Ingredients: Whether it contains antibiotics, hormones, vitamins, alkaloids, or other specific chemical/biological components. 2. Packaging Form: Whether it is in tablets, capsules, liquid, powder, or pre-packaged for retail. 3. Purpose: Therapeutic, prophylactic (preventive), or diagnostic.
⚠️ Key Distinction:
- If the product is a general drug not falling under specific subheadings (like antibiotics or vitamins), it may fall under 3004.90 (Other medicaments).
- If the product contains specific alkaloids or derivatives (e.g., morphine, quinine), it may fall under 3003.49 or 3004.49.
- Critical Warning: Misclassification of pharmaceuticals can lead to severe customs delays, seizure, or heavy penalties due to regulatory controls (FDA/Health Canada/etc.).

🔍 Important Reminder:
- Pre-packaged vs. Bulk: 3004 codes generally apply to pre-packaged medicaments for retail sale. 3003 codes often apply to bulk or non-retail packaged medicaments.
- Ingredient Specificity: If the "Medicament" contains antibiotics (e.g., penicillin), it falls under 3004.41-3004.44. If it contains hormones, it falls under 3004.19-3004.39. The codes above (3004.49,3003.49) are for "Other" medicaments.
- Regulatory Compliance: All pharmaceutical imports require FDA registration, NDC numbers (in the US), or equivalent local health authority approvals.

协调制度(HS)是由世界海关组织(WCO)制定的国际贸易商品分类标准。全球 200 多个国家采用 HS 系统作为海关关税、贸易统计和进出口监管的基础。
每个 HS 编码遵循以下层级结构:
- 章(2 位)——商品大类(例如:第 84 章:机器和机械设备)
- 品目(4 位)——章内的更具体分类
- 子目(6 位)——国际通用细分,所有 WCO 成员国统一使用
- 本国细分(8-10 位)——各国自行扩展的细分编码,如美国 HTSUS 10 位编码
正确的 HS 编码归类对于顺利通关、准确缴纳关税和遵守贸易法规至关重要。错误归类可能导致海关延误、多缴关税或罚款。
